Transaction 68b5969869f86c29036b01a427b2ec8486ba5afa32d838b204ed33c73f68a2bb

1 Input
2 Outputs
  • 68b5969869f86c29036b01a427b2ec8486ba5afa32d838b204ed33c73f68a2bb:0
  • value  116000
    address  2Myc5jyHaSuQH3pRkQGyP7H6jJxoE1HVG8V
  • 68b5969869f86c29036b01a427b2ec8486ba5afa32d838b204ed33c73f68a2bb:1
  • value  125797211
    address  2NAA7qKemkX38snmgAHkqNephi1VWjgs92p